This past Sunday I spoke at Bayside Woodland Church near Sacramento, California. It’s about eight hours’ drive from our home, and RobAnne and I decided to drive together. We were going to meet the music pastor of the church, who’s a good friend, and we wanted to take him and his wife out to dinner. That meant that RobAnne and I spent sixteen hours in the car together.

Do you know what happened? When all was said and done – and it was a long, fatiguing drive – conversation took place. Conversation takes work, time, and effort to put away the distractions. When you’re in a car for sixteen hours with your wife, there aren’t many other distractions.

Remember the story in the Old Testament when the Children of Israel were crossing the Jordan, and God instructed the people to build a pile of rocks? When their children asked them what those rocks were for, they would be able to tell them the great miracles that God did – how God led them and took care of them and directed them and promised them. The rocks symbolized that God is faithful.

Every year there is a competition at Westmont College, where my daughter goes to school and where RobAnne and I went. The competition involves eight-minute musical skits put on by each dorm. The skits are judged, and the winner is given bragging rights for the year. It takes place at the Santa Barbara Bowl, which holds a couple thousand people, and it’s full – full of people enjoying college students being college students, having good clean, fun.
